Welcome aboard! The hardware lab on level 2 of the Brindle Annex is keypad-only — no tailgating, even for people you recognise. Facilities desk folks should log every lab entry they grant in the Tinwork tracker before end of shift. Safety glasses live in the bin by the door. When you need to let someone in, punch in the code below.

staff pass of kawip-hawef = bdg-QLP-2

Assigning for review. Since the pool refactor landed, the Mapfennel tile-rendering cache drops connections under load — roughly 3% of render requests fail with pool-exhausted errors, spiking during zoom-level rebuilds. Suspect the new idle-timeout interacts badly with the cache's long-lived prepared statements. Repro: run the tile soak script against staging for ten minutes. Logs attached. Please check whether the reconnect logic honors the retry budget. Staging cache DB is reachable via the connection string below.

replica DSN, kajep-yahag: mssql://praok_svc:iF@db-8d68.plorvaio.local:5432/eliion

Changed defaults for the Brightfern clinic reminder job (v2.9). Heads up, future maintainers: the job now sends reminders 48 hours out instead of 24, after the Oakhollow pilot showed fewer no-shows. Quiet hours are respected by default, and SMS retries dropped from five to two because carriers were flagging us. If you need the old behavior, override it per-tenant. The job ships with the following default configuration values.

config for yajef-tajof:
[belius]
host = belius.crelvolabs.internal
user = belius_svc
database = belius_prod

## Deployment: Stale-Branch Cleanup Bot

Heads up, support folks: Twigsweep is the little bot that prunes branches nobody has touched in 60 days. It runs nightly after the Brackenford build window, opens a warning issue a week before deleting anything, and skips branches tagged `keep`. If a customer claims a branch vanished, check the bot's audit log first — nine times out of ten it left a warning that got ignored. Its deployment settings are as follows.

service settings:
[casax]
port = 6379
team = rusir
host = casax.zemvarhq.corp
region = outer-4
access_code = ac_9808ce
timeout_ms = 1500